The video discusses the UK housing market trends, focusing on the impact of stamp duty changes, surveyor optimism, and inventory levels. It explores the two-tier market structure, regional differences, and the effects of construction and planning changes. The potential impact of upcoming elections and interest rates on the market is also examined, with a focus on regional price increases in Scotland and Northern Ireland.
